AI summary

Mardia Samyoung Capillary Tubes Company has allotted 2,34,80,000 (about 2.35 crore) fully convertible equity warrants to 6 non-promoter individuals on a preferential basis. The warrants carry an issue price of Rs. 13.50 each, including a Rs. 3.50 premium over the Rs. 10 face value. This is the fourth tranche of the preferential issue, following shareholder approval in October 2025 and BSE in-principle approval in January 2026. Each allottee will hold roughly 4.86% to 4.97% of the company's post-issue share capital upon full conversion. Allottees have paid 25% upfront, with the remaining 75% due within 18 months when they choose to convert the warrants into equity shares. Since these are warrants and not shares, there is no immediate change in paid-up share capital.

Likely market impact

This is a dilutive event for existing shareholders — if all warrants are converted, the company's equity base will expand significantly. However, no equity dilution happens right now, and the 25% upfront payment brings some cash into the company. Shareholders should watch whether the allottees eventually convert within 18 months, which would increase the share count and dilute their stake.
